Webnumpy.convolve. #. numpy.convolve(a, v, mode='full') [source] #. Returns the discrete, linear convolution of two one-dimensional sequences. The convolution operator is often seen in signal processing, where it models the effect of a linear time-invariant system on a signal [1]. In probability theory, the sum of two independent random variables ... Web18 Jan 2015 · Smooth bivariate spline approximation in spherical coordinates. New in version 0.11.0. Parameters: theta, phi, r : array_like. 1-D sequences of data points (order is not important). Coordinates must be given in radians. Theta must lie within the interval (0, pi), and phi must lie within the interval (0, 2pi). w : array_like, optional. WebSmoothing a data set using a Savitzky-Golay filter Generating a noisy data set As explained above, we use a filter whenever we are interested in removing noise and/or fluctuations from a signal. We hence start our example by generating a data set of points that contains a certain amount of noise.
